Child welfare intake is the first point where someone raises a concern about a child, and the system receives the data and decides what to do next. Child welfare intake is where everything begins. The first few decisions taken here often shape the entire journey of a case. But in reality, this stage is messy, information comes in bits and pieces, decisions depend on individual judgment, and important details are sometimes missed. When this happens, vulnerable children may not receive the right attention at the right time. In this paper, we present a governance-aware conceptual framework and proof-of-concept implementation of a multi-agent artificial intelligence (AI) system designed to support child welfare intake and early risk identification. We have envisioned a system where the data entry will be done using a conversational interactive chatbot interface, and the system will have multiple agents to perform specific tasks such as analyzing the data, assessing risk, checking data quality, and monitoring bias. Also, there will be a Central Orchestrator, which will manage all the agents and maintain the sequence of the workflow. A couple of important ideas we've planted in our proposed system are that if the system is not confident about the output it generates, it does not propagate to the next phase; instead, it passes the case to a human in the loop. Also, the system asks human-friendly questions if the response from the user is incomplete. These features make the system more thoughtful rather than just rushed, and they help ensure that uncertain or high-risk situations are not handled only by automation. Our intention through this article is not to reduce human involvement in the child welfare system or to take over the role of caseworkers. Our main goal is to propose an agentic AI-enabled support system for caseworkers that has the potential to improve the consistency, completeness, and governance of child welfare intake processes. With appropriate real-world validation, the proposed system may play a supportive role in helping vulnerable children receive attention earlier.
